Adrian Peterson stars as Minnesota Vikings beat San Diego Chargers

Peterson stars as Vikings beat Chargers

The Minnesota Vikings have beaten the San Diego Chargers 31-14 with a convincing performance at the TCF Bank Stadium this evening.

Blair Walsh put the opening points on the scoreboard for the hosts with a 24-yard field goal in the first quarter.

Things then became a little more lively in the second, with Adrian Peterson picking up the first touchdown of the game and his first since 2013 to help the Vikings to a 10-0 lead.

The Chargers came back into it with just over a minute remaining in the second quarter, however, when Philip Rivers found Keenan Allen for a 34-yard touchdown.

Into the third, and Peterson got his second touchdown of the day by breaking three tackles on a 43-yard run.

Zach Line then got in on the action with a one-yard touchdown, taking the score to 24-7.

Linebacker Chad Greenway extended the lead for the Vikings early on in the fourth quarter, running an incredible 91 yards with teammates in tow to find the endzone.

Allen touched down for the Chargers in the dying embers of the game after receiving the ball from Kellen Clemens, but it was no more than a consolation score for Mike McCoy's side.
